The management of displaced intra-articular calcaneal fractures (DIACFs) represents one of the most challenging domains in modern traumatology and orthopedic foot and ankle surgery. The calcaneus, functioning as the primary load-bearing foundation of the posterior foot, is subjected to immense compressive, torsional, and shear forces during normal gait. When compromised by high-energy axial loading—commonly seen in industrial falls, vehicular collisions, or winter alpine sports accidents—restoring the complex sub-talar articular congruence, Böhler’s angle, and Gissane’s angle becomes imperative to prevent disabling post-traumatic osteoarthritis and chronic hindfoot deformity.
According to clinical studies published in European trauma registries, restoration of Böhler’s angle to its anatomical baseline (20°–40°) reduces long-term sub-talar joint fusion requirements by up to 64%. Our engineering team has meticulously benchmarked international traumatology standards to produce an implant system that balances rigid angular stability with soft-tissue friendliness. The key technological pillars include:
Ultra-slim 1.5mm profile with rounded, chamfered plate edges to significantly reduce soft-tissue irritation, skin necrosis, and tendon impingement over the lateral calcaneal wall.
Pre-angled locking threaded holes specifically oriented toward the sub-talar articular surface and sustentaculum tali for maximal pullout resistance in cancellous heel bone.
Easily cuttable and contourable mesh/web bridge configurations that allow trauma surgeons to tailor the plate shape intraoperatively based on unique fracture geometries.
